General Health Overview

See health data visualized

Metric Harlan County Nebraska Avg US Average
Life Expectancy (years) 81.1 79.5 78.3
Uninsured Population (%) 8.4% 7.4% 8.5%

Life expectancy in Harlan County is 81.1 years, about 1.6 years longer than the Nebraska average of 79.5 years.

The uninsured population in Harlan County is 8.4%, higher than the Nebraska average of 7.4%.

Disease Prevalence

Disease / Condition Harlan County Nebraska Avg US Average
Diabetes 11.6% 11.0% 11.3%
Cancer 9.1% 8.0% 6.9%
Heart Diseases 8.3% 7.5% 7.1%
Adult Obesity 36.7% 36.1% 34.3%
Self-Rated Poor Health 12.8% 12.9% 16.3%

On average, diseases in Harlan County are about the same as in Nebraska.

Health Behaviors

Behavior Harlan County Nebraska Avg US Average
Smokers 16.3% 16.6% 19.0%
Binge Drinking 18.1% 19.7% 16.5%
Sedentary Lifestyle 24.5% 24.3% 25.1%

On average, health behaviors in Harlan County are about the same as in Nebraska.

Air Quality

Metric Harlan County Nebraska Avg US Average
Air Pollution (μg/m³) 5.24 5.27 6.09

With an annual average of 5.2 µg/m³ of fine particulate matter (PM2.5), air quality in Harlan County is good — generally safe air quality for the vast majority of residents.
